Transaction 529f7ec75abaa05df3622550d8a69503f1efbc69e12448acd10110825c3019a0
1 Input
1 Output
-
529f7ec75abaa05df3622550d8a69503f1efbc69e12448acd10110825c3019a0:0
- value
- 11175613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72b1b8e4525d8fa2b0a79e84331b79598dc16a1c OP_EQUAL
- address
- 3C9TrmbaKvviv2wSQ5XRzx5t1xsQTxSYc2